| Features:
| • | Displays calories burned | | • | Shows when you're improving your fitness based on your heart rate | | • | Comes with comfortable textile transmitter and coded heart rate transmission to avoid cross-talk. | | • | Button free operation of wrist unit | | • | Water Resistant |

Product Description A watch after your own heart, this device keeps tabs on your workouts by monitoring heart rate and alerting you when you've hit your desired intensity, how many calories you've burned and how close you are to reaching your long and short term goals. 2-year limited warranty. Model FT4.

Exactly what I was looking for May 30, 2010 Duane W. Richards (Cedar Hills, UT United States) 6 out of 6 found this review helpful
I'm new to heart rate monitors, so I had a lot of searching to do to figure out what I needed from one before I placed my order. I soon found that the Polar brand was the one to get, but they have hundreds of models, ranging from affordable to incredible. I know some will say this model doesn't have it all, but if you're looking for something to keep you informed of your progress in your exercise routine, this is really all you need. Tracking up to 10 sessions worth of data, but also keeping a running total, the watch can tell you how long you worked out, your average heart rate, maximum reached, and time in the zone, and from that, how many calories you burned. It beeps softly at you every 5 seconds or so when you're under the zone, and also tells you when you've exceeded your maximum. The display is really easy to read, even in the middle of vigorous training session. The watch in comfortable and easy to clean, as is the chest strap, which is fully adjustable. I have no complaints at all, and for the price, I'm extremely pleased. I only wish there was a way to download the training files from the watch to my computer, but a spreadsheet also works just fine.

I am 74 years old and had open heart surgery in December of last year and was advised during my cardiac rehab to keep my heart rate under 110. During rehab, I always wore a heart monitor. However, after I got out on my own, I needed a device that would allow me to monitor my heart rate while exercising. The Polar FT4 has worked perfectly. It transmits my heart rate to all of the exercise machines that I use at my health club and allows me to follow my doctors orders. It is a great device and I highly recommend it to anyone wishing to monitor their heart rate.
